D/F is for tougher fights. D/D would be ok for it’s better mobility when doing say map completion or general running around. I would grab a staff if nothing else to swap in and hit the swiftness/static field+Blasts to keep the speed going, some fights you may even want it so you can range and kite.

Personally I went with S/F for a lot of the open world stuff as I could simply run the quick spike damage rotation and blow up enemies quickly, I’d go D/F or Staff when things got tougher.

Big difference between pve and pvp is that you can change your weapons around when out of combat and get the skills. Swap to Focus and obsidian flesh to run through things without getting in combat, swap in staff for speed. Even maybe swap S/D run a might stacking rotation and swap back to your dagger quickly to burn things down quicker? Just saying you have options on your weaponry always at your finger tips… well as long as you’re out of combat.

@ Xialoh’s more sustain build… Retrait the 2 points of water into earth for stone splinters… is a perma +10% dmg buff since u’ll always be in melee range with D/X. The Water-trait isn’t always up^^

Yup yup, I originally wanted to use Stone Splinters for dmg modifiers but Healing Mist provides a good sustain against condi opponents like destroyers (burning), kraits (bleeding), hyleks (poison darts). Edit: Can always put in Water V if the mobs can crit you.

@OP: I used d/d for “funsie” during those times when I know I could kill mobs fast (with just muscle reflex), usually in sub 80 maps. D/D has good mobility and rapid CC against a group of mobs. Burning speed and might blasting is a big enough burst and Lightning Whip can give you sustainable dps against Veteran. You could use d/d in Silverwaste too, but you will have to be careful when picking the enemy and minding your position. I always resort to staff there because I’m lazy and I like my extra dodge and big numbers. An extra bonus of staff is its CC works really well against “jumpy” mobs like Mordrem Wolf, Tegariff and Hyena.
